If you’re in the process of buying or selling a home in New Jersey and need certified PWTA testing, we’ve teamed up with Innovative Water Solutions Laboratories in Bordentown, NJ. They are an independent, certified third-party laboratory capable of conducting various certified water tests, including the state-required Private Well Testing Act Testing. With this partnership, we can streamline and simplify the process of a real estate transaction and get you the highest quality water and testing possible

PFOA chemicals, also known as Perfluorooctanoic Acid, are a type of synthetic chemical that belongs to a larger group called per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S); they are used to make products resistant to stains, grease, water, and soil, often found in non-stick cookware, carpets, and certain clothing due to their water-repellent properties; considered "forever chemicals" because they don't easily break down in the environment and can accumulate in the human body over time.
